Embed the PeriomaticTM Computation Core into Your Products

A hybrid IC that allows you to integrate F/V conversion functions (or F/D conversion for the FUD-16) directly onto your own circuit boards, powered by our proprietary Periomatic-B method.

Universal specifications allow you to configure custom full-scale conversion values for inputs ranging from 0.006 Hz to 500 kHz. Achieve high precision, rapid response times, and simplified system design.

Provides advanced backward compatibility with the legacy KAZ-7400 model. Simply drop it in to replace older units and immediately benefit from 16-bit high resolution and low calculation noise performance.

High-Precision Gating System

COCORESEARCH's proprietary frequency measurement technology, Periomatic-B. It precisely measures and averages the number of pulses and periods within the gate time, eliminating pulse count errors typical of standard gating systems and performing robustly against pulse irregularities.

High Accuracy Under Drastic Changes

One of the key strengths of Periomatic is its predictive computation, ensuring high accuracy even during abrupt speed variations. You can configure the optimal deceleration/stop response according to the specific stopping characteristics of the rotating body.

16-Bit High Resolution for I/O

Features a high-speed clock achieving an input resolution of 42 ns and a voltage resolution of approx. 1/57,000 at 100% output voltage.

Ultra-Wide Range Support

Supports a wide range from 0.006 Hz to 500 kHz, allowing you to define any custom measurement range.

Backward Compatible

Easily replace the KAZ-7400 to upgrade your system's input/output resolution and overall performance.

4 Types of Output & Mounting

Four distinct models are available: Analog or Digital output, with either Horizontal or Vertical mounting configurations.

Spread Function

The spread function allows you to magnify and measure specific desired measurement sub-ranges.

Logarithmic Output

Outputs the entire range logarithmically at once. Custom range selection is available.

Frequency/Period Selector

Select whether the output is directly proportional to the frequency or to the period.

Input Pulse Averaging

Automatically compensates when pulse cycles are uneven within the gating period.
> Learn More

Chatter Suppression

Suppresses chattering noise from relay contacts, photocouplers, and other signal sources.

Dual Range *

Allows you to switch dynamically between two different full-scale range settings.

Stepless Smoothing

Converts step-like outputs occurring at every gate update interval into a smooth, continuous line graph output.

Comparator Output

Compares the input signal frequency with preset thresholds to evaluate high/low status limits.

Standstill Detection

Detects complete stops or standstills by setting the comparator threshold close to zero.

FUD Series (Digital Output Type)

Direct Frequency-to-Digital Conversion for Superior Tracking
Eliminates offset errors, minimizes span errors, and ensures exceptionally low temperature drift.

Enhanced Precision and Speed Over Traditional Analog F/V + A/D Chain
Eliminates A/D conversion errors and avoids time-lag bottlenecks since no conversion processing latency is required.

CMOS Level Serial Output for F/D Conversion Data
Enables highly compact system architecture and miniaturization.

User-Friendly System Parameters
Configure technical parameters via direct communication with an MPU, a dedicated setting terminal, or serial communication with a PC. Designed for effortless integration into microcomputer-driven architectures. Configured baselines are saved in the onboard EEPROM.
